How much do new grad network eng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for new grad network engineer in California is $107,612.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$87,800.00 and $131,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ges new grad network engineers face when transitioning from academic projects to real-world network environments?

New grad network engineers often find the transition to professional settings challenging due to the complexity and scale of enterprise networks compared to academic lab environments. Real-world networks involve working with legacy systems, adhering to strict security protocols, and troubleshooting issues that may not have clear documentation. Additionally, new grads must quickly adapt to working collaboratively with cross-functional teams, such as security analysts and systems administrators, while managing multiple priorities and responding to unexpected network incidents. However, these challenges offer valuable learning opportunities and pave the way for rapid skill development.

What is the difference between New Grad Network Engineer vs Network Technician?

AspectNew Grad Network EngineerNetwork Technician
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in Computer Science or related field; certifications like Cisco CCNAHigh school diploma or associate degree; certifications like CompTIA Network+
Work EnvironmentDesign, implement, and troubleshoot network systems; often in office or data center settingsInstall, maintain, and repair network hardware; on-site or fieldwork
Employer & Industry UsageIT firms, telecom companies, large corporationsTelecom providers, IT support companies, small businesses

While both roles involve networking skills, a New Grad Network Engineer focuses on designing and planning networks, often requiring a degree and certifications. In contrast, a Network Technician primarily handles installation and maintenance tasks, typically with less formal education. Understanding these differences helps new professionals choose the right career path in the networking industry.

What does a New Grad Network Engineer do?

A New Grad Network Engineer is an entry-level professional responsible for helping design, implement, maintain, and troubleshoot computer networks for organizations. They typically work under the supervision of more experienced engineers to ensure network reliability, security, and performance. Their tasks may include configuring routers and switches, monitoring network activity, assisting with network upgrades, and resolving connectivity issues. New Grad Network Engineers often work with IT teams to support daily network operations and may also help document network configurations and procedures.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a New Grad Network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a New Grad Network Engineer, you need a solid understanding of networking fundamentals, protocols (such as TCP/IP), and a relevant deg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with network hardware, configuration tools, and certifications like Cisco's CCNA are highly beneficial.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ication set standout candidates apart. These skills and qualities are essential for ensuring reliable network performance, troubleshooting issues efficiently, and collaborating within IT teams.

Network Engineer
Employment Type: Full Time, Experienced level
Department: Information Technology

CGS is seeking an experienced Network Engineer to join a team focused on the evaluation, enhancement, and maintenance of a large scale network project that includes both wired and wireless network infrastructure and related hardware & software.  The project's objectives are to evaluate the current setup of existing disparate networks and design & implement a network infrastructure that encompasses the wireless, wired, and software network requirements.  The project will also include consultation regarding hardware and software necessary to facilitate the proper support for this encompassing infrastructure, and the associated systems testing, vulnerability assessments, and quality assurance needed to implement the new setup.  This Network Engineer will interface with state and local governmental personnel, internal stakeholders, subject matter experts, and vendor(s) who will provide development services.

CGS brings motivated, highly skilled, and creative people together to solve government's most dynamic problems with cutting edge technology. To carry out our mission, we are seeking candidates that are excited to contribute to government innovation, appreciate collaboration, and can anticipate the needs of others. Here at CGS, we offer an environment in which our employees feel supported, and we encourage professional growth through various learning opportunities.

Skills and attributes for success:
- Operate and manage NPS network infrastructure;
- Improve infrastructure monitoring and reporting capabilities based on the deployment of network management software;
- Develop, maintain and deliver infrastructure documentation relating to the network infrastructure within the NPS environment;
- Review current best practices and provide recommendations for architecture, design, management and operation of the network infrastructure;
- Administration of the Cloudpath (or equivalent) onboarding process, monitoring and troubleshooting of wireless network health, maintenance of wireless network infrastructure, implementation of network security patches and software/firmware updates, from 0800 to 1700 PST, Monday-Friday;
- Assess the NPS network infrastructure and make recommendations on improvement and optimization;
- Define and conduct testing procedures for new infrastructure projects;
- Implement technology solutions within the NPS network environment;
- Provide design guidance on network solutions within NPS infrastructure projects;
- Provide informal training and knowledge transfer to NPS resources on best practices and theory of operation relating to network products.

Qualifications:
- Bachelor's Degree from an accredited college or university in Engineering, Computer Science, Business, Information systems or a related discipline.
- Strong documentation skills including updating JIRA Tickets, Wiki Pages and Network Diagrams
- Ability to communicate with end users, cross-organizational staff and technical assistance center.
- CWNA Certification  or equivalent
- BCNE Certification or equivalent
- Experience utilizing (RF) site survey tools such as Ekahau, RF Scanners and Wireshark packet capture software
- Strong knowledge of layer 2 switching and layer 3 routing protocols; including VLANs, 802.1w, OSPF and VRRP
- Strong knowledge of network security including; 802.1x, MAC Authentication, ACLs, RADIUS and Certificate of Authority (CA)
- Strong knowledge of troubleshooting RF and LAN issues
- Working knowledge of LINUX, MS Server 2013, VMware, etc.
- A Master's Degree in Engineering, Computer Science, Business, Information systems or a related discipline
- At least 3 years experience with disaster recovery plan creation / implementation testing or projects 
- Experience with penetration testing, vulnerability assessment, and vulnerability testing
- Experience with cyber threat information collection and analysis
- Working knowledge of Agile/SCUM project management methodologies
- Additional Industry certifications/licences
